Please check with your service provider before purchasing this modem. I was told by the Best Buy associate that "Because it works with Comcast it would work with Optimum." The internet worked at 75/100 MBps, and the phone line, which is why I picked this particular modem, did not work at all. I spent about two weeks back and forth with Optimum and Netgear trying to update the firmware. Neither wanted to take responsibility. Finally I just returned it, and ordered an Arris TM822 from the Best Buy website. Best Buy needs to stock the modems that are compatible with the local ISPs. Optimum denies any compatibility with "Comcast Certified" devices despite what anyone in-store will tell you.

I purchased this cable modem to replace the modem provided to me by Comcast. I grew tired of the "replace your router" solution every time I called technical support. It also bugged me that every time I replaced the modem, it was a different manufacturer and usually a model that was no longer supported.
This modem was a snap to configure, literally taking a few minutes from out of box to registered and connected to the Internet. I didn't even have to call Comcast.
I've used the modem for months without issue, with both improved performance and reliability compared to the Comcast modems I used previously.
